Jobs for Nursing Midwifery Grads in Rhode Island
In this state, there are 320 people employed in jobs related to a nursing midwifery degree, compared to 61,960 nationwide.
Wages for Nursing Midwifery Jobs in Rhode Island
In this state, nursing midwifery grads earn an average of $78,450. Nationwide, they make an average of $81,350.
Nursing Midwifery Careers in RI
Some of the careers nursing midwifery majors go into include:
| Job Title | RI Job Growth | RI Median Salary |
|---|---|---|
| Nursing Instructors and Professors | 21% | $73,910 |
| Nurse Midwives | 0% | $109,550 |
